Again, thanks! | | | | Joined: Mar 2009 Posts: 134 Shop Shark | | Shop Shark Joined: Mar 2009 Posts: 134 | Rewired my 53 5 window 216 with a harness from classic parts, upgraded it to 12 volt all went well execpt I have no power going to the gas gague or the instruments lights. Any ideas?

| | | | | Joined: Sep 2001 Posts: 29,269 Bubba - Curmudgeon | | Bubba - Curmudgeon Joined: Sep 2001 Posts: 29,269 | Charley, Those leads most likely come from the ignition switch, the fuse box, or the light switch. Short wires/leads are often not included with a reproduction harness (but extra lengths of wires of different gauges are sometimes included). Light switch The fuel gauge hot lead comes from ignition switch. | | | | | Joined: Jan 2009 Posts: 1,644 Shop Shark | | Shop Shark Joined: Jan 2009 Posts: 1,644 | The gas gauge is fed from the ing. switch when you turn on the ign. switch it feeds power to the gauge
the dash lites are fed from the head lite switch thru the dimmer circuit when you pull the switch out to the frist indent the lites should come on some switches you'll need to hook up a dash lite HOT to that circuit on the head lite switch.
